#!/usr/bin/env python # encoding: utf-8 # go.py - Waf tool for the Go programming language # By: Tom Wambold import platform, os import Task import Utils from TaskGen import feature, extension, after Task.simple_task_type('gocompile', '${GOC} ${GOCFLAGS} -o ${TGT} ${SRC}', shell=False) Task.simple_task_type('gopack', '${GOP} grc ${TGT} ${SRC}', shell=False) Task.simple_task_type('golink', '${GOL} ${GOLFLAGS} -o ${TGT} ${SRC}', shell=False) def detect(conf): def set_def(var, val): if not conf.env[var]: conf.env[var] = val goarch = os.getenv("GOARCH") if goarch == '386': set_def('GO_PLATFORM', 'i386') elif goarch == 'amd64': set_def('GO_PLATFORM', 'x86_64') elif goarch == 'arm': set_def('GO_PLATFORM', 'arm') else: set_def('GO_PLATFORM', platform.machine()) if conf.env.GO_PLATFORM == 'x86_64': set_def('GO_COMPILER', '6g') set_def('GO_LINKER', '6l') set_def('GO_EXTENSION', '.6') elif conf.env.GO_PLATFORM in ['i386', 'i486', 'i586', 'i686']: set_def('GO_COMPILER', '8g') set_def('GO_LINKER', '8l') set_def('GO_EXTENSION', '.8') elif conf.env.GO_PLATFORM == 'arm': set_def('GO_COMPILER', '5g') set_def('GO_LINKER', '5l') set_def('GO_EXTENSION', '.5') if not (conf.env.GO_COMPILER or conf.env.GO_LINKER or conf.env.GO_EXTENSION): raise conf.fatal('Unsupported platform ' + platform.machine()) set_def('GO_PACK', 'gopack') set_def('GO_PACK_EXTENSION', '.a') conf.find_program(conf.env.GO_COMPILER, var='GOC', mandatory=True) conf.find_program(conf.env.GO_LINKER, var='GOL', mandatory=True) conf.find_program(conf.env.GO_PACK, var='GOP', mandatory=True) conf.find_program('cgo', var='CGO', mandatory=True) @extension('.go') def compile_go(self, node): try: self.go_nodes.append(node) except AttributeError: self.go_nodes = [node] @feature('go') @after('apply_core') def apply_compile_go(self): try: nodes = self.go_nodes except AttributeError: self.go_compile_task = None else: self.go_compile_task = self.create_task('gocompile', nodes, [self.path.find_or_declare(self.target + self.env.GO_EXTENSION)]) @feature('gopackage', 'goprogram') @after('apply_compile_go') def apply_goinc(self): if not getattr(self, 'go_compile_task', None): return names = self.to_list(getattr(self, 'uselib_local', [])) for name in names: obj = self.name_to_obj(name) if not obj: raise Utils.WafError('object %r was not found in uselib_local ' '(required by %r)' % (lib_name, self.name)) obj.post() self.go_compile_task.set_run_after(obj.go_package_task) self.go_compile_task.dep_nodes.extend(obj.go_package_task.outputs) self.env.append_unique('GOCFLAGS', '-I' + obj.path.abspath(obj.env)) self.env.append_unique('GOLFLAGS', '-L' + obj.path.abspath(obj.env)) @feature('gopackage') @after('apply_goinc') def apply_gopackage(self): self.go_package_task = self.create_task('gopack', self.go_compile_task.outputs[0], self.path.find_or_declare(self.target + self.env.GO_PACK_EXTENSION)) self.go_package_task.set_run_after(self.go_compile_task) self.go_package_task.dep_nodes.extend(self.go_compile_task.outputs) @feature('goprogram') @after('apply_goinc') def apply_golink(self): self.go_link_task = self.create_task('golink', self.go_compile_task.outputs[0], self.path.find_or_declare(self.target)) self.go_link_task.set_run_after(self.go_compile_task) self.go_link_task.dep_nodes.extend(self.go_compile_task.outputs)
